CHARLOTTE, N.C. (AP) — Coach Matt Rhule says he feels good about the way the Panthers practice and is disappointed former quarterback Teddy Bridgewater didn’t feel the same way while he was in Carolina.

Rhule's comments came after Bridgewater criticized Panthers offensive coordinator Joe Brady and the Panthers on the “All Things Covered” podcast for a lack of practice in the red zone and two-minute drills.

The Panthers traded Bridgewater to the Denver Broncos earlier this offseason after acquiring Sam Darnold in a trade with the New York Jets.
